Most people lose their chubby cheeks when they go below 20% body fat. At 15% (or less) even stubborn face fat is gone. Your starting point will determine how long it will take. Note: you can expect to lose about 0.5-1% of body fat a week.

Injection lipolysis involves the injection of a solution that digests fat cells, reducing the double chin. Patients must receive this treatment multiple times at 4-6 week intervals for the best results. Laser lipolysis also targets fat cells but is not invasive, melting fat via heat energy from a laser beam.
The primary cause of a fat face is excess fat in the buccal fat pads. Why is my face fat but not my body? You may have a genetic pre-disposition to chubby cheeks even though you have a slim body. Also, some people are born with thicker buccal fat pads in their cheeks while the rest of their bodies are slim.
